> These are a number of assorted upstream Linux fixes to the
> BRCMNAND driver that I have backported in an attempt to get
> BRCMBCA working with U-Boot (still not there).
>
> This patch set lowers the hamming distance between the Linux
> and U-Boot drivers a bit as well, while we deviate quite
> a bit it is still possible to bring fixes over thanks to
> exercises like this.
>
> The set tries to prepare the ground for the BCMBCA driver
> which I have a port of which is however not yet working
> as it should. This is why the read data callback is included.
>
> These patches seem to work fine for me with my devices but
> I know the maintainers have some nice test farms so try to
> put these to test and see if we can merge them. I bet the
> Broadcom folks has this on their TODO list anyway.
